What does "task" mean?
-
noun A specific piece of work that needs to be done.
"Cleaning the garage was today's first task."
-
noun (computing) A unit of work or a running instance of a program that a computer executes.
"The background task finished syncing the files."
-
verb To assign someone a piece of work or responsibility.
"She was tasked with organizing the entire conference."
